Transaction 91e4df58aa69d80f81e53d9c419f35afa8b62f40f18d557f4480344c752e177f

1 Input
2 Outputs
  • 91e4df58aa69d80f81e53d9c419f35afa8b62f40f18d557f4480344c752e177f:0
  • value  670514
    address  194mCshDh4QgaHr6po8JNFGHUiSJT2RNjG
  • 91e4df58aa69d80f81e53d9c419f35afa8b62f40f18d557f4480344c752e177f:1
  • value  1000000
    address  396c2SLLvMKwXncNrKu7ThS4QDXaz6Pv9j